SPARTANBURG, SC — AFL, a provider of products and services to the broadband market, is supplementing its technologically-advanced Fujikura fusion splicer product line with the Fujikura 62S, an active core alignment splicer featuring exceptional splice loss performance and minimized splice time. With a conventional flip-open wind protector and non-motorized tube heater, the complexity of the splicer is reduced without compromising total cycle time. Additionally, the number of steps to process splices is minimized with the auto-start feature for both the splicing and tube heating process.

Enhanced Durability and Productivity
The Fujikura 62S ensures a high level of productivity with the 23-second shrink time using standard splice sleeves. By incorporating ruggedized features, a mirrorless optical system and impact-resistant monitor, durability is enhanced. The transit case doubles as a built-in or mobile workstation and makes splicing easier.
Additional features of the Fujikura 62S include:
- A 5,000 splice electrode life
- Li-ion battery with 200 splices/shrinks per charge
- 5 mm cleave length for splice-on connectors or small package needs
- Sheath clamp or fiber holder operation
- Internet software upgrades
